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ander tenants and landlords involved in a tenancy or social housing matter can ask for their case to be included in NCAT’s Aboriginal Tenancy List.

The Aboriginal Tenancy List is held every 2 weeks on a Wednesday. People who cannot attend in person may be able to take part by telephone or virtual hearing.
NCAT’s Do you need legal help? fact sheet (PDF, 460.3 KB) lists free services that provide legal information, advice and referrals for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people living in NSW.
This includes services such as the Aboriginal Legal Service NSW/ACT, Aboriginal Tenants Advice and Advocacy Services, Legal Aid NSW’s Civil Law Service for Aboriginal Communities and community legal centres.
